# Closure of the Ashenby Office (Managers Only)

This page briefs the incoming director on the planned closure of our Ashenby satellite office. The site serves eleven staff; nine have accepted transfers to the Marridge hub, and two departures are being handled by HR with standard severance terms. The lease expires at quarter-end and will not be renewed. Client accounts have been reassigned without disruption. External communication remains embargoed. The strategic reasoning behind the closure is recorded in the confidential note below.

internal memo for yahof-kawif: The northern region missed its Wenok quota by 7.2 percent last quarter. Istirix Partners plans to lower the Novmir list price by 57.6 percent in January. The finance team signed off on a budget of $96.5 million for Project Istox. The renewal with Istirek Partners closes at $343.6 million a year, 7.5 percent below the last contract.

**Is sorting stable in Reportsmith builds?**

Yes, as of release 4.2. Rows with equal sort keys keep their source order across all export formats. Earlier builds were stable only for CSV. Anything pinned to 4.1 or older should be flagged in release notes. The verification checklist used at cut time is on the page below.

dashboard of bafof-hafog = https://confluence.lumiclabs.internal/display/browse/display/6a09a20a

Subject: Legacy Pricing Adjustment — Briefing for Branch Managers

Colleagues,

From April, customers on legacy Meridial plans will see a 6% increase, phased over two billing cycles. Scripts and objection-handling guidance follow next week. Please ensure front-line staff do not speculate on further changes. The rationale connects to broader commercial plans, summarised confidentially just below.

confidential, kagep-kahof: Druokax Systems plans to lower the Ulaath list price by 53 percent in March.

Handover note — Crumbwheel order cutoffs.

Welcome aboard. The bakery cutoff rule in Crumbwheel closes same-day orders at 14:00 local to each storefront, not UTC — this has bitten us twice. Holiday overrides live in the calendar service and take precedence silently, so always check there first when a cutoff looks wrong. To unlock the calendar service's admin console after a restart, enter the recovery passphrase below.

vault phrase of bagap-bahaf = silion-pelox-sorox-casdor-quenwyn-fraax-eliox-praael-kelion-quenvan-kasox-rusael-norius-belvan